Washington Wizards owner and former owner of both the Capitals and Mystics Abe Pollin has passed away at age 85.
Pollin owned Washington Sports & Entertainment, the company that owns both the Wizards and the Verizon Center, making him in large part responsible for the revitalization of Chinatown. He was the longest-tenured owner in the NBA, and brought NHL to DC.
He graduated from George Washington University in 1945, started his own construction business in 1957 with his wife Irene. His presence in the DC community will be missed but his contributions to DC sports remain.
